Les algorithmes de trading ont révolutionné les marchés financiers en permettant des transactions rapides, des stratégies optimisées et une gestion automatisée des risques. Cependant, malgré leurs nombreux avantages, ces systèmes présentent plusieurs limites, particulièrement dans des environnements de marché imprévisibles ou très volatils. Voici un aperçu des principales limitations des algorithmes dans de tels contextes.
1. Dépendance aux données historiques
Les algorithmes de trading, en particulier ceux basés sur l’apprentissage automatique et les modèles statistiques, reposent fortement sur les données passées pour prendre des décisions. Si ces données ne reflètent pas fidèlement les conditions futures du marché, l’algorithme peut se retrouver à prendre des décisions erronées.
- Changement de régime du marché : Un algorithme qui a été optimisé sur des données de marché historiques pourrait ne pas bien réagir face à des événements inédits ou des changements brusques de tendance. Par exemple, un algorithme conçu pour des marchés haussiers pourrait échouer lorsqu’un marché baissier survient soudainement.
2. Incapacité à anticiper les événements imprévus
Les algorithmes sont limités par leur incapacité à anticiper des événements externes imprévus, comme des crises géopolitiques, des catastrophes naturelles ou des scandales économiques qui peuvent provoquer de fortes perturbations du marché.
- Réactions de panique : En période d’incertitude, comme lors d’une crise financière ou d’une pandémie, les réactions humaines, souvent basées sur des émotions comme la peur, peuvent causer des mouvements brusques et non anticipés sur les marchés. Les algorithmes peuvent réagir de manière excessive à ces événements, amplifiant parfois la volatilité.
3. Difficulté à traiter les données non structurées
Les algorithmes de trading sont généralement meilleurs pour traiter des données structurées (par exemple, des prix, volumes, et tendances passées). Cependant, dans des marchés imprévisibles, des données non structurées comme les opinions sur les réseaux sociaux, les déclarations politiques ou les nouvelles économiques peuvent influencer les mouvements du marché.
- Sentiment mal capté : Bien que des techniques comme l’analyse de sentiments existent, elles ne sont pas infaillibles. L’IA peut mal interpréter le ton ou le contexte de certaines informations et, par conséquent, réagir de manière incorrecte.
4. Vulnérabilité aux anomalies du marché
Les marchés imprévisibles peuvent créer des anomalies, comme des mouvements extrêmes et soudains, que les algorithmes de trading peuvent ne pas savoir gérer efficacement.
- Flash crashes : Des événements comme un « flash crash », où un actif perd une grande partie de sa valeur en quelques minutes, peuvent déstabiliser les algorithmes qui fonctionnent sur des logiques préétablies. Ces systèmes peuvent vendre à des prix trop bas, exacerbant la chute des prix.
5. Manque de flexibilité face aux changements rapides
Les algorithmes sont généralement programmés pour suivre des règles prédéfinies et réagir de manière systématique. Cela peut les rendre moins flexibles face à des conditions de marché qui changent rapidement, notamment dans des périodes de forte volatilité ou d’incertitude.
- Réactions lentes : Bien que les algorithmes soient rapides dans leurs exécutions, leur rigidité algorithmique peut entraîner une lente adaptation aux nouvelles informations, notamment dans des situations de crise où une réaction immédiate est nécessaire.
6. Dépendance à l’infrastructure technique
Les algorithmes de trading nécessitent une infrastructure technique robuste pour fonctionner efficacement, notamment des serveurs rapides, des systèmes de gestion de la latence et des connexions fiables aux marchés.
- Défaillances systémiques : En période de forte volatilité, si l’infrastructure sous-jacente rencontre des problèmes (par exemple, des pannes de serveur ou des bugs dans le code), cela peut entraîner une mauvaise exécution des ordres et une amplification des pertes.
7. Comportement non prévisible en mode autonome
Certains algorithmes, en particulier ceux utilisant des techniques d’apprentissage profond (deep learning), peuvent évoluer de manière imprévisible une fois qu’ils sont en mode autonome, prenant des décisions qui ne sont pas toujours comprises ou anticipées par les concepteurs.
- Opérations risquées : Dans un marché imprévisible, ces systèmes peuvent parfois prendre des positions excessivement risquées ou mal adaptées aux conditions, en raison de mauvaises estimations ou d’une mauvaise interprétation des données.
8. Problèmes d’overfitting
L’overfitting se produit lorsque l’algorithme est trop ajusté aux données historiques et devient trop spécifique à un certain ensemble de données, rendant ses prédictions moins fiables dans des situations nouvelles.
- Manque de généralisation : Un algorithme qui est suroptimisé pour une situation passée peut échouer lorsqu’il est confronté à des conditions de marché qui ne ressemblent en rien à celles utilisées pour l’entraîner.
9. Risques liés à l’interconnexion des marchés
Les algorithmes de trading sont souvent conçus pour interagir avec d’autres systèmes et sont parfois interconnectés à grande échelle. Lorsqu’une défaillance se produit dans un système ou qu’un mouvement de marché est amplifié par des algorithmes de trading concurrents, cela peut créer des boucles de rétroaction négatives.
- Cascade de ventes : Si plusieurs algorithmes réagissent de manière similaire à un événement, cela peut entraîner une cascade de ventes ou d’achats, provoquant une instabilité accrue sur le marché.
10. L’impact des régulations
Les régulations des marchés financiers peuvent influencer de manière imprévisible l’efficacité des algorithmes, notamment dans les environnements où des modifications soudaines de régulation ou des restrictions gouvernementales sont imposées.
- Adaptation lente : Les algorithmes peuvent ne pas être en mesure de s’adapter instantanément aux changements de régulation, ce qui peut entraîner des pertes ou des erreurs.
Conclusion
Les algorithmes de trading offrent d’énormes avantages, mais leur efficacité dépend fortement de la prévisibilité du marché. Dans des environnements imprévisibles ou volatils, les algorithmes peuvent avoir du mal à s’adapter, entraînant des risques accrus. Les traders doivent être conscients de ces limitations et veiller à utiliser des stratégies qui combinent à la fois des capacités humaines et des systèmes automatisés, tout en restant flexibles pour faire face à des conditions de marché changeantes.

















